Visualisation and Analysis of the 2020 - 2024 Production Line Balancing Study Based on VOSviewer and CiteSpace

Ruoqian Pan, Haifeng Yu

Abstract


Production line balancing is significant in optimizing smart manufacturing and industrial engineering. Based on 1432 documents
(171 in Chinese and 1261 in English) collected by CNKI and Web of Science from 2020-2024, this paper uses VOSviewer and CiteSpace to
conduct visual analysis, which reveals the research dynamics: the average annual growth rate of English documents reaches 22.3%, while the
volume of Chinese documents is The hotspots have experienced three stages of basic modelling (2020-2021), efficiency optimization (2021-
2022) and intelligent collaborative decision-making (2022-2024), with the main focus on multi-objective genetic algorithms, digital twins and
human-machine ergonomics integration. In the future, it is necessary to strengthen the in-depth integration of intelligent algorithms and industrial practices, build a carbon-neutral oriented green balance system, and promote the standardised development of human-machine collaborative mechanisms.

Keywords


Production line balancing; Bibliometric analysis; CiteSpace; VOSviewer
